2TechMan

From £189/monthUnlimited usersCommonly 3-year contract

The most established dedicated UK cloud garage management system, with three tiers (Lite/Advanced/Pro) offering progressively deeper reporting and multi-site support.

Best for: larger or multi-site independents that need advanced reporting and can absorb a higher price and longer contract.

3Garage Hive

From £89–145/month + per-user MS licence6-month minimum term

Popular with 3–8 bay independents and known for a strong user community. Runs as an add-on to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central, so a separate per-user Microsoft licence (roughly £61.50–84.60/user/month) applies on top of the Garage Hive fee itself.

Best for: workshops already invested in (or wanting) the Microsoft Business Central ecosystem.

4GDS (Garage Data Systems)

From £149–299/monthSetup fee £350–£1,500Usage credits for SMS/VRM/Haynes Pro

Part of the ClearCourse group, with separate Workshop Manager and Commercial Vehicle Manager products — the latter aimed specifically at fleet/heavier-vehicle compliance and inspection needs.

Best for: workshops that handle commercial or fleet vehicles alongside standard servicing.

6Dragon2000 (DragonDMS)

Pricing not published30-day free trial

A 30-year-old provider whose customer base spans used-car dealerships as much as independent garages, with stock/retail and web advertising features alongside workshop management.

Best for: dealerships that sell used cars as well as running a service department.

Which garage management software has no long-term contract?

GarageDash and AutoChain both operate with no minimum term — cancel any time. TechMan is commonly sold on 3-year terms, and Garage Hive requires an initial 6-month term. GDS and Dragon2000 contract terms are not published and vary by quote.
